%0 Journal Article %T PENGETAHUAN TENTANG ROKOK, PUSAT KENDALI KESEHATAN EKSTERNAL DAN PERILAKU MEROKOK %A Sitti Chotidjah %J Makara Seri Sosial Humaniora %D 2012 %I Universitas Indonesia %R 10.7454/mssh.v16i1.1493 %X This study was to determine the effect of an external health locus of control on smoking behavior mediated byknowledge about smoking in adolescent boys. The sampling technique was accidental sampling. Subjects were 110adolescents aged 15-20 years from Yogyakarta. Reliability test results demonstrate the scale of the external health locusof control has good reliability (¦Á = 0.854), while a test of knowledge about smoking have KR-20 = 0.311 and scale ¦Á =0.405 smoking behavior, which means that two instruments are less reliable. In addition, the research data did not meetthe assumptions of normality (a = 0.005 < 0.05) and linearity that are required to analyze the data in path analysis. Thetest results with t-test showed that there were differences in external health locus of control (t = -0.913, p = 0.363; F =1.360, p = 0.204 > 0.05) and knowledge related to smoking (t = 1.572, p = 0.119; F = 1, 276, p = 0.261 > 0.05) amongregular and experiment smokers. Spearman correlation test results showed there is a correlation between smokingbehavior with external health locus of control (rs = 0.210, p = 0.027 < 0.05) but there is nota correlation betweensmoking behavior with knowledge related to smoking (rs = 0.155, p = 0.105 > 0, 05). %K health external locus of control %K knowledge related to smoking %K smoking behavior %U http://journal.ui.ac.id/index.php/humanities/article/view/1493
